Regulations and Permits for Pergolas in Moncada

Navigating the legalities of home improvements in the Horta Nord requires local expertise. In Moncada, all outdoor structures must comply with the Spanish and European safety standards, specifically the UNE-EN 13561, which dictates the wind resistance and safety requirements for solar protection systems and blinds. Beyond these technical standards, any installation is governed by the municipal urban planning regulations.

The urban development in Moncada is primarily governed by the PGOU (Plan General de Ordenación Urbana) of 1989. While this plan has seen various modifications, it remains the baseline for what is permitted on your plot. For most bioclimatic pergolas, which are considered "desmontable" (removable) structures because they are not made of heavy masonry, the process is usually handled as an "Obra Menor" (Minor Work). This requires a simple communication to the Ayuntamiento de Moncada and the payment of the corresponding municipal taxes (ICIO).

However, if your property is located within a protected area or near buildings of historical interest—common in the older parts of the Barrio del Pilar or near the town’s heritage sites—the project must strictly adhere to the LOTUP (Ley de Ordenación del Territorio, Urbanismo y Paisaje) of the Valencian Community. This may involve stricter aesthetic controls to ensure the pergola does not clash with the local heritage protections. How much does a bioclimatic pergola cost in Moncada?
The price generally falls between 300 € and 780 € per square metre. This range accounts for the high-quality extruded aluminium used, the motorised slat system, and the professional labour required for a secure installation in the Horta Nord area. Factors such as integrated LED lighting, rain sensors, or glass lateral enclosures will move the price toward the higher end of the spectrum.
Do I need a licence for a pergola in Moncada?
Yes, you generally need a "Comunicación Previa" or an "Obra Menor" permit from the Moncada Town Hall. Because these pergolas are considered lightweight and non-permanent structures, the process is usually straightforward. However, if you live in a community of owners (Comunidad de Propietarios), you will also need formal approval from your neighbours according to the Ley de Propiedad Horizontal.

Can the pergola withstand the "Gota Fría" rains?
Yes, our bioclimatic pergolas are designed specifically for the Mediterranean climate. They feature an integrated gutter system within the pillars that channels water away from the structure. When the slats are fully closed, the roof is completely watertight, protecting your terrace furniture even during the intense autumn storms typical of the Valencia region.
Will a bioclimatic pergola help cool my house?
Definitely. By installing the pergola against a facade, you create a thermal buffer. In the summer, you can angle the slats to block direct sunlight from hitting your windows while still allowing hot air to escape upwards. This "chimney effect" can significantly reduce the temperature of the adjacent indoor rooms, leading to lower air conditioning costs during the Moncada summer.
